UFC Fight Recap: Ryohei Kurosawa vs. Keito Yamakita

In an electrifying showdown that lit up the octagon, Keito Yamakita emerged victorious over Ryohei Kurosawa via a first-round knockout at ONE Samurai 1. The stakes for this bout were high, as it was a clash between two highly touted prospects looking to make a memorable mark in their respective divisions. Both fighters were hungry for recognition, with Yamakita aiming to solidify his contender status, while Kurosawa sought to interrupt Yamakita’s rise.

How the Fight Played Out

From the moment the fight began, it was clear this would be a contest to remember. Yamakita started strong, showcasing his striking prowess with a series of rapid jabs that kept Kurosawa on high alert. As the round progressed, it became evident that Yamakita was controlling the pace, advancing forward with confidence while maintaining a solid defensive stance.

A key moment unfolded just two minutes into the round when Yamakita landed a powerful right hook that staggered Kurosawa. This punch shifted the momentum decisively in Yamakita’s favor. Sensing his opponent was on shaky ground, Yamakita moved in for the finish, employing a blend of kicks and punches aimed at overwhelming Kurosawa.

Kurosawa, known for his grappling skills, attempted to recover by initiating a takedown. However, Yamakita’s footwork and defense held steady under pressure, enabling him to thwart the attempt and remain on his feet. The combination of striking speed and tactical composure showcased Yamakita’s skillful execution during the fight.

Turning Points

The turning point of the fight came with just over a minute left in the first round. Following a fierce exchange, Yamakita landed a devastating knee strike that sent Kurosawa crashing to the mat. It was a spectacular move that left the audience roaring in approval. As Kurosawa struggled to regain his footing, Yamakita saw an opportunity and unleashed a series of ground-and-pound strikes. The referee had no choice but to step in and call a stop to the bout, declaring Yamakita the winner by TKO.
